Abstract

A conversion entity and method for converting higher-rate speech parameters into lower-rate parameters including dimmed excitation parameters. The conversion entity comprises a first decoder configured to produce a target excitation from the higher-rate parameters, based on a first fixed contribution and a first adaptive contribution. The conversion entity also comprises a second decoder configured to produce a second adaptive contribution, and configured to selectably operate in a first or a second mode. In the first mode, the second adaptive component is generated based on the first fixed contribution for a previous frame, while in the second mode, the second adaptive component is generated based on a second fixed contribution for the previous frame. The second decoder operates in the second mode in response to a rate reduction request. A processing module determines the dimmed excitation parameters for generation of the second fixed contribution for the current frame, based on the target excitation and the second adaptive contribution.
